This section breaks down the goal statistics of Fylkir and KA in the Úrvalsdeild. This information is crucial in better understanding how the two teams’ offences and defences have performed during the current campaign.
In terms of how Fylkir has performed with scoring and conceding goals in the Úrvalsdeild, here’s a quick summary:
Goals scored - Fylkir in Úrvalsdeild
- Fylkir has scored 12 goals in 9 matches for an average of 1.33 goals scored per match.
- As the home side, Fylkir has scored 6 goals in their 5 home matches in the Úrvalsdeild, resulting in 1.2 goals per match at home.
- And as the visiting side, Fylkir has 6 goals scored in 4 away matches for an average of 1.5 goals scored per away match.
Goals conceded - Fylkir in Úrvalsdeild
- Defensively, Fylkir has conceded 25 goals in 9 matches, giving them an average of 2.78 goals conceded per match.
- At home, Fylkir has given up 9 goals in 5 matches for an average of 1.8 goals conceded per home match.
- And away from home, their record is 16 goals given up in 4 matches, resulting in 4 goals conceded per away contest.
For KA, this is how many goals they have scored and conceded:
Goals scored - KA in Úrvalsdeild
- KA has scored 13 goals in 9 matches played, giving them an average of 1.44 goals scored per match in this campaign.
- As the away team, KA has scored 3 times in 3 for an average of 1 goals scored per match.
- And at their home ground, KA has 10 in 6 home matches, which comes out to an average of 1.67 goals scored per match.
Goals conceded - KA in Úrvalsdeild
- KA’s defence has let in a total of 23 goals in 9 matches thus far. As a result, they are averaging 2.56 goals conceded per match.
- Away from home, KA has conceded 12 goals in 3 matches. That gives them an average of 4 goals given up per away match.
- On home soil, meanwhile, KA has the following stats: 6 matches, 11 goals surrendered for an average of 1.83 goals conceded per match.
